      "The time has come." The Empress whispered in my ear, her pale fingers curled around my shoulders, her nails cut into my flesh. "To pledge your allegiance. Whose side will you stand on?" Her cold breath fanned my skin, and I resisted a shiver. She pushed me down so I was no longer standing, but sitting on a bejewelled throne made of a thousand bones. The one she had made, just for me.

"Do you like it?" She asked, while taking a moment to admire the craftsmanship. "I had it polished with liquid diamond. And the rubies, I had them shaped into roses. Your favourite flower, yes?" She didn't wait for an answer, her eyes lovingly moved over the red jewels. "I was going to wait, but I'm no good with surprises." A tinkling giggle left her lips.

      I tried to swallow the bile that was rising in my throat, tried to control my shallow breathing. I could feel sweat trickling down my back. Discomfort settled in my stomach, as betrayal and anticipation mixed together.

      She walked around the throne, to the silver table in front of me. A silky fabric of maroon covered a tray. Now she stood across from me. The Empress sank to her knees, allowed her arms to rest on the table. She cupped her face with both hands. The mannerism, so innocent it was almost childlike.

"My treasure," she spoke in a melody, sweet as honey, "the Prophecy is upon us. Your Destiny has come to find you. You must choose." Her voice which had once soothed, now disgusted. Wide green eyes expectantly watched me. I held her gaze until I recognised the hard glint in her eyes that she always tried to mask with love.

      Love, she knew nothing of it, could only try to replicate it.  Betrayal, had shattered my heart in millions. It's toxic taste poisoned my mouth, a bitter sour tang. I bit my tongue holding back the rage that threatened to be released like a tsunami. The Empress, she had used me, and I, being so blinded by love, had allowed her to. To her, I was nothing more then a pawn in a chess game. A game she knew all the moves to. Merely a piece to be collected and kept. And, that thought alone made my knees go weak. A riot of emotions rattled through my body, shaking me to my core.

     It seemed I was seeing her for the first time without illusion clouding my eyes. A vision of serene monstrosity, heartbreakingly beautiful, but her aura...it reeked of malice. What had she done to obtain that beauty, that power, that throne? I didn't want to know the answer, but felt the truth seep into my mind. It could not be ignored, I could not be ignorant to the evil she housed, allowed, revelled in. Despite this, at the moment all I felt was betrayal. Tears gathered in my eyes until The Empress became a blur, only when they trekked down my cheeks did I see her clearly.
